NPCI readies UPI framework for AI agents to make rule-based purchases
India’s UPI network is preparing a Unified Agent Protocol that would let AI agents execute payments within set rules, starting with frequent low-value purchases such as groceries. Proposed controls include spending caps, identity checks, audit trails and a liability framework.
